红联Linux门户
Linux帮助

请教Linux下如何使用U盘?

发布时间:2008-07-15 11:48:36来源:红联作者:simon_siming
linux 使用USB设备问题

环境:虚拟机中安装Linux FC4,内核为2.6.17-1.2142。
虚拟机已添加USB接口,并设为“...USB设备自动连接到虚拟机”。在U盘插入后,虚拟机下

有显示USB图标。但用fdisk -l却显示不到U盘。同时,使用dmesg查看时,也显示不到U盘

的详细信息。其中dmesg显示相关信息如下:
-----------------------------------------------------------------------------
...
usb 1-1: new full speed USB device using uhci_hcd and address 2
usb 1-1: configuration #1 chosen from 1 choice
Initializing USB Mass Storage driver...
scsi1: SCSI emultion for USB Mass Storage devices
usb-storage: device found at 2
usb-storage: waiting for device to settle before scanning
usbcore: registered new driver usb-storage
USB Mass storage suppor registered.
usb 1-1: reset full speed USB device using uhci_hcd and address 2
usb 1-1: reset full speed USB device using uhci_hcd and address 2
usb 1-1: reset full speed USB device using uhci_hcd and address 2
usb 1-1: reset full speed USB device using uhci_hcd and address 2
usb-storage: device scan complete
...
-----------------------------------------------------------------------------
然后在网上搜了下资料,还做了以下尝试:
先别插U盘,/sbin/lsmod看是否有usb-storage。发现没有,然后执行以下操作
1)、 cd /lib/modules/2.4.20-8/kernel/drivers/usb
2)、 for v in *.o storage/*.o ; do /sbin/insmod $v ; done
但提示以下信息:
insmod: can't read '*.o':No such file or directory
insmod: can't read 'storage/*.o': No such file or diectory


补充:在装linux系统时并没有添加usb接口设备。是想试试如何使用U盘时,才通过虚拟

机添加一个USB接口设备的。不知会不会与这个有关呢?
在纯字符和已装xwindows图形界面的linux下都尝试过.一样的问题...

请问这是怎么回事呢?谢谢指教!!!

[ 本帖最后由 simon_siming 于 2008-7-15 17:00 编辑 ]
文章评论

共有 2 条评论

  1. simon_siming 于 2008-07-15 16:32:03发表:

    嗯,谢谢楼上的。。。
    一会试试在有装xwindows的虚拟机上试试。。。
    期待ing
    (5ty(

  2. 逸之兔 于 2008-07-15 12:28:24发表:

    linux是图形界面的话,U盘插入后,自然会显示啦。:0wl;l1 我在虚拟机显示一切正常啊。(6)m:b